Huxley crossed swords with Samuel Wilberforce, at the 1860 Oxford meeting of the British Association, has been often … Web26 nov. 2013 · During this debate, Wilberforce asked Huxley whether on his father’s side or on his mother’s side Huxley claimed his descent from a monkey.
